MMIKHAIL UDALOVGood to all travelers! We stayed at this hotel as a family. We rented two rooms. The hotel is new. No more than two years after the opening. The description of the hotel and rooms fully corresponds to the website. I must say right away that the hotel can be rated five out of five, everything else is not the fault of the hotel and its service. This is a problem common to the entire island of Phu Quoc. The island is preparing to host a major economic summit in 2027. The whole island is one big construction and reconstruction project. It is not surprising that suddenly reconstruction and equipment for a new tourist facility (hotel, shop, restaurant, etc.) can begin in neighboring buildings, but we must pay tribute to the fact that the silence regime is still observed. This is Saturday and Sunday, a complete ban, repairs are possible only from 8:00 to 11:00 from 13:00 to 17:00. HL Melody in the neighboring block is completing reconstruction for its own apartments, that is, it is expanding its offer. It is said that everything will be finished by March 2026. But I repeat, it's everywhere on the island and on Khem in particular. If you think that hotels such as La Grotta, All Sand, Paralia, ANN and others of this class of hotels will be better, then you are mistaken. Construction and reconstruction are going on everywhere. Unlike these hotels, the location of HL is much better, far from the noise of the crowd of vacationers, the noise of passing cars and bikes. Khem Beach is a 10-minute slow walk away. The windows of rooms 101, 201, 301, and so on overlook the rainforest. At night, we turned off the air conditioner and slept with the windows open in complete silence. In the morning, we were only bothered by the roosters of the neighboring village and the forest birds. Tips for nearby restaurants - Chinese Fu Lu Kang (excellent work by a professional chef, instant service, full Chinese menu, except for Peking duck, we recommend absolutely everything). Grill Station is a decent menu when you want to switch from Vietnamese cuisine. Com Nha Vietnamese Cuisine is the latest restaurant on the way to the beach. Very affordable prices and excellent food quality. Better than on the beach - Draft Beer Bai Khem. We used the last one when we were at the beach all day. I recommend all the listed restaurants. KingKong has the best currency exchange, while Khem has a 1% worse exchange rate. If you skip the transport to KingKong, then the course is the same. The general advice on Khem's vacation location is if finances allow, then Premier Residence, New Wolrd, JW Marriott. That is, the territories that were closed and completed for reconstruction with half board. The latter is important because Vietnamese cuisine is sparse and monotonous. At the same time, you are guaranteed that you do not have large-scale repairs with the demolition of floors behind your wall. We recommend the Shop-center and farm of sea and river pearls - Ngoc Hien Pearl Farm. You can even book a transfer from the hotel if you really intend to buy something. HL Melody service: very good. The Ngoan concierge is a very polite and helpful employee. Our respect. Rooms: new and clean. Cleaning was carried out every day. Towels are changed every day. The linen is all snow-white and dry. Please note that there is an error in the description of one of the rooms. There is only one kitchen for self-catering and breakfast on the ground floor. In the lobby there is a stove, refrigerator, dishes, professional coffee machine, water, drinks, Two bicycles in free use. Internet - WIFI is fast without freezes. There's an elevator in the hotel, but you can't hear it at all. In general, the sound insulation is good. We recommend this hotel. The price is fair and affordable, and the service corresponds to the hotel class. I repeat that the problems of reconstruction are a problem of Phu Quoc in any new location of tourist clusters - Marina, SunSetTown, Khem, and etc.

MMIKHAIL UDALOVGood to all travelers! We stayed at this villa as a family. We liked the villa very much, we rate it 10/10. The house's design is thoughtful. The rooms are well thought out and well equipped. The bathrooms are very nice. The landscaping with tropical trees and flowers is great. Bougainvillea is great. The night lighting of the villa is very impressive. Every three days there is a complete cleaning and replacement of all towels. The linen is new, dry and spotlessly white. There is a washing machine. It helped a lot with rinsing beach clothes, T-shirts, and beach towels. Everything was dry in the morning. The kitchen is equipped with everything you need, but I would advise the manager to change one of the pans, add 8 earthenware cups instead of plastic ones and 10 pieces of small teaspoons and add 8 large plates for the main course. In this case, there will be nothing to complain about. Our extended family was comfortable staying in this villa. Everything is completely consistent with the description. The location is in a quiet location in the complex of the same Sun Tropical Village villas. Security with a barrier around the perimeter, video cameras and more. Everything is great, but take into account one very important point. This is a problem common to the entire island of Phu Quoc. The island is preparing to host a major economic summit in 2027. The whole island is one big construction and reconstruction project. And not all the villas in this complex are ready for operation. At the moment, only 30% are involved. The rest are being put into operation very quickly. With us, one of the neighboring villas was fully equipped by about 40 workers, from concrete to complete furniture and landscaping in 12 days. The pace is impressive. So, if your villa is nearby, then you will have noise problems. I talked to one of these residents, who complained that he had a villa for rent for a month, and nearby repairs. Fortunately, during our stay with Evelyn, preparatory work was just beginning. Tips for nearby restaurants - Chinese Fu Lu Kang (excellent work by a professional chef, instant service, full Chinese menu, except for Peking duck, we recommend absolutely everything). Grill Station is a decent menu when you want to switch from Vietnamese cuisine. Com Nha Vietnamese Cuisine is the latest restaurant on the way to the beach. Very affordable prices and excellent food quality. Better than on the beach - Draft Beer Bai Khem. We used the last one when we were at the beach all day. I recommend all the listed restaurants. KingKong has the best currency exchange, while Khem has a 1% worse exchange rate. If you skip the transport to KingKong, then the course is the same. The general advice on Khem's vacation location is if finances allow, then Premier Residence, New Wolrd, JW Marriott. That is, the territories that were closed and completed for reconstruction with half board. The latter is important because Vietnamese cuisine is sparse and monotonous. At the same time, you are guaranteed that you do not have large-scale repairs with the demolition of floors behind your wall. We recommend the Shop-center and farm of sea and river pearls - Ngoc Hien Pearl Farm. You can even book a transfer from the hotel if you really intend to buy something. Service: very good. Concierge is a very polite and helpful employee. Our respect. Rooms: perfect Two bicycles in free use. The manager needs to fix the seat on one of the bicycles and lubricate the chains. Internet - WIFI is fast without freezes. I recommend this villa for 10/10, but I advise you to check about possible repairs before renting.
